Android Setup Steps
For Android, you start by downloading the APK file from the official mobile app page. Your browser might warn you because the file isn’t from the Google Play Store. That’s typical for direct downloads, but only proceed if you’re confident you’re on the official Princess Casino website. Once the download finishes, open the file and follow the prompts. You’ll be required to allow installations from unknown sources in your device settings – this option is generally under security or app installation settings, according to your Android version. After that, the app installs in seconds. Then you can open it and sign in.
- Access the official Princess Casino website on your Android device.
- Navigate to the mobile app page and tap the Android download button.
- Hold for the APK file to download completely.
- Open the APK file and confirm the installation prompt.
- If prompted, allow installations from unknown sources.
- Launch the app and log in to access the New Releases section.
iOS Installation Steps
iOS users in France can install the app using a configuration profile or a direct App Store link, depending on what the official page shows at the time. The app works on iPhone and iPad models running supported iOS versions. After tapping the download button, you may need to confirm before the app appears on your home screen. If the installation uses a profile, you’ll need to go to Settings > General > VPN & Device Management and trust the developer certificate. You only need to do this for apps distributed outside the App Store. Once the certificate is trusted, the app opens normally. Maintain the profile installed to receive updates.
